From d4026d9db720dfcc6a6953d7aaaf3e7897353536 Mon Sep 17 00:00:00 2001 From: rwatson Date: Tue, 20 Aug 2002 02:53:35 +0000 Subject: Provide stub mpo_syscall() implementations for mac_none and mac_test. Obtained from: TrustedBSD Project Sponsored by: DARPA, NAI Labs --- sys/security/mac_none/mac_none.c | 9 +++++++++ sys/security/mac_stub/mac_stub.c | 9 +++++++++ sys/security/mac_test/mac_test.c | 9 +++++++++ 3 files changed, 27 insertions(+) (limited to 'sys/security') diff --git a/sys/security/mac_none/mac_none.c b/sys/security/mac_none/mac_none.c index e473dd8..0813011 100644 --- a/sys/security/mac_none/mac_none.c +++ b/sys/security/mac_none/mac_none.c @@ -98,6 +98,13 @@ mac_none_init(struct mac_policy_conf *conf) } +static int +mac_none_syscall(struct thread *td, int call, void *arg) +{ + + return (0); +} + /* * Label operations. */ @@ -934,6 +941,8 @@ static struct mac_policy_op_entry mac_none_ops[] = (macop_t)mac_none_destroy }, { MAC_INIT, (macop_t)mac_none_init }, + { MAC_SYSCALL, + (macop_t)mac_none_syscall }, { MAC_INIT_BPFDESC, (macop_t)mac_none_init_bpfdesc }, { MAC_INIT_CRED, diff --git a/sys/security/mac_stub/mac_stub.c b/sys/security/mac_stub/mac_stub.c index e473dd8..0813011 100644 --- a/sys/security/mac_stub/mac_stub.c +++ b/sys/security/mac_stub/mac_stub.c @@ -98,6 +98,13 @@ mac_none_init(struct mac_policy_conf *conf) } +static int +mac_none_syscall(struct thread *td, int call, void *arg) +{ + + return (0); +} + /* * Label operations. */ @@ -934,6 +941,8 @@ static struct mac_policy_op_entry mac_none_ops[] = (macop_t)mac_none_destroy }, { MAC_INIT, (macop_t)mac_none_init }, + { MAC_SYSCALL, + (macop_t)mac_none_syscall }, { MAC_INIT_BPFDESC, (macop_t)mac_none_init_bpfdesc }, { MAC_INIT_CRED, diff --git a/sys/security/mac_test/mac_test.c b/sys/security/mac_test/mac_test.c index e6b5da8..4ccae53 100644 --- a/sys/security/mac_test/mac_test.c +++ b/sys/security/mac_test/mac_test.c @@ -187,6 +187,13 @@ mac_test_init(struct mac_policy_conf *conf) } +static int +mac_test_syscall(struct thread *td, int call, void *arg) +{ + + return (0); +} + /* * Label operations. */ @@ -1142,6 +1149,8 @@ static struct mac_policy_op_entry mac_test_ops[] = (macop_t)mac_test_destroy }, { MAC_INIT, (macop_t)mac_test_init }, + { MAC_SYSCALL, + (macop_t)mac_test_syscall }, { MAC_INIT_BPFDESC, (macop_t)mac_test_init_bpfdesc }, { MAC_INIT_CRED, -- cgit v1.1